At the heart of his self-sufficient farm was the chicken coop, located just steps from his house. In the coop, John raised chickens both for personal use and for sale, an endeavor that had brought him steady satisfaction and income over the years. Occasionally, he would find stray eggs scattered around, especially near the greenhouse where the hens loved to roam. By now, he was used to these little discoveries and rarely gave them much thought. One morning, however, something unusual caught his eye: a small pile of black eggs near the chicken coop. Curious, he collected them and decided to incubate them to see what would hatch. When the eggs finally cracked open, the surprise was even greater. The chicks that emerged were Ayam Cemani, a rare and striking breed known for its completely black pigmentation—from feathers to skin, bones, and even internal organs. After doing some research, John discovered the source of the mysterious eggs: a neighbor’s hen, a collector of rare breeds, had wandered onto his property and laid her precious eggs in his coop. This unexpected discovery brought a touch of the exotic to John’s farm, opening up a new world of possibilities. It enriched his daily life and made his homestead even more unique.
